Default Alec Bradley Cigars

I've never actually tried an Alec Bradley cigar... I've heard quite a few good things about his various blends, but have yet to actually try one.

So a few days ago when browsing CigarAuctioneer, I came across a box of the Alex Bradley Sun Grown Robusto's. I believe it is a famous exclusive. Sun grown wrappers are one of my favorites, right next to Maduro. These things look excellent. They should be here by Tuesday or Wednesday.

$55.00 for a box of 20, hard to beat that.

Anyone enjoy Alec Bradley cigars?

Anyone know anything about his new New York-only cigar, the Empire State edition (or something like that)? I just saw that this will be released on Oct. 1 to NY retailers. I guess this was made out of protest to that state's 75% wholesale tax.
